Set to return
Landers (COVID-19 protocols) is set to return ahead of Wednesday's matchup with TCU, Arne Green of the Topeka Capital-Journal reports.
Impact
Landers missed the last two games for the Wildcats in COVID-19 protocols but is likely to play Wednesday. The 6-foot-9 freshman has averaged 1.1 points and 1.2 rebounds on 6.8 minutes per game this season. Kansas State will also have their other center, Kaosi Ezeagu, likely returning from COVID-19 protocols ahead of an important conference rivalry game.
